    I bought a 2008 Prius two years ago, but it's been sitting, and now it starts, but the "triangle of death" is lit, as are the other indicators, and I can't shift it out of park, so I believe the traction battery might be toast. I let it run for a couple of hours in the hope that the battery might recharge, and I noticed that the internal combustion engine shut down periodically, so it almost seems like the batteries are charging, but I still see the indicators. Any suggestions on how to easily determine the state of the battery and how to recondition it if necessary?

    At a minimum you'll need a OBD2 scanner to retrieve the stored codes (DTCs), a hybrid compatible OBD2 scanner would be best.

    Many here use a "mini-vci" cable, and techstream (toyota diagnostic software).
